C10700 Copper vs. Type 3 Magnetic Alloy

C10700 copper belongs to the copper alloys classification, while Type 3 magnetic alloy belongs to the nickel alloys. There are 27 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(6,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is C10700 copper and the bottom bar is Type 3 magnetic alloy.
